Empowering our people, enriching our workplace

At NDTV, we are committed to the holistic well-being of our employees by fostering a workplace that prioritises work-life balance, diversity and inclusion, and continuous learning. Through structured engagement programmes and initiatives, we ensure that our people feel valued, empowered, and equipped to thrive both personally and professionally
Key people-focused initiatives
Crèche Facility Launch:

We introduced an in-house crèche under #NDTVCares, offering a family-friendly workplace where children (up to 14 years) can drop in anytime – whether for daycare or just to see their parents at work.

Women’s Day Celebrations:

As part of our commitment to gender inclusion, we celebrated International Women’s Day 2024 with engaging panel discussions, mentorship programmes, and employee appreciation events.

Mental Health and Well-Being Programmes:

This year, we introduced dedicated wellness sessions, stress management workshops, and counselling support, ensuring holistic employee well-being

#Iamthechange initiative

This engagement framework continues to build a strong sense of community through festive celebrations, cultural events, and employee recognition programmes

Quarterly Focus Group Discussions (FGDs):

We expanded our employee feedback mechanism, conducting discussions that generated over 650 insights from more than 300 employees across Noida, Delhi, and Mumbai offices, leading to actionable improvements.

Learning Oriented Onboarding Programme (LOOP):

Our structured induction programme ensures that new hires seamlessly integrate into the organisation, gaining essential knowledge about our culture, policies, and processes.

POSH Awareness Workshops:

We reinforced our commitment to a safe and inclusive workplace through specialised training sessions on the Prevention of Sexual Harassment (POSH), led by certified expert Dr Israel F. Inbaraj.

PI Behaviour Assessment:

This specialised Train-the-Trainer programme, conducted by The Predictive Strategy Group (TPSG), continued to enhance leadership and interpersonal skills among employees.

Young Managers Programme (YMP):

The programme was further strengthened this year, helping young leaders enhance their team management, delegation, feedback delivery, and time management skills through interactive training sessions.

Chairman’s Survey

Your Voice Matters: Our annual employee engagement survey invited feedback, ensuring continuous improvement in policies and work culture.
